Batō is a character from the manga Butsu Zone. He is a Bodhisattva, a figure from the Buddhist realm who manifests in the human world. His role among the other awakened beings is that of a powerful and reliable fighter, often positioned as an elder brother figure. He is described as an aloof big brother and a big brother mentor, suggesting a personality that is somewhat distant or reserved but ultimately protective and guiding toward his allies, particularly the younger characters like the protagonist Sennju.
Batō's primary motivation stems from his duty as a protector. As a member of the Kannon Bodhisattvas, he is part of a group dedicated to helping and shielding humanity. He possesses the greatest fighting ability among this group, and his role in the story is to use his immense strength in combat against the forces that threaten the mission to protect Sachi, the reincarnation of Buddha. His key relationship is with the other Bodhisattvas, where he acts as a mentor and a bastion of strength. He shares a close bond with his comrades, fighting alongside them as part of a team of powerful beings.
In terms of development, Batō is presented as an already mature and formidable warrior. His character arc is less about personal change and more about the application of his established power and loyalty in the service of a greater cause. He is a steadfast figure who provides crucial support in battle, demonstrating a consistent and reliable nature.
Batō's notable abilities are tied to his nature as a multi-armed and dangerous Bodhisattva. He wears a suit of power armor that grants him enhanced combat capabilities. His signature weapon is an axe, and he wields several of them, including an extremely large one that serves as his finishing move. Reflecting his tough and combative demeanor, his human form takes visual inspiration from the character of the Mariachi in the film Desperado. He is also associated with riding a motorcycle, reinforcing his image as a badass biker.
